Color formulation encompasses the type of dye—permanent, semi-permanent, or temporary. Permanent dyes offer longer-lasting results but can be harsher on hair. Semi-permanent options provide a less damaging alternative, while temporary dyes are great for occasional use. Skipping the Patch Test: Skipping the patch test can have serious consequences. A patch test helps detect allergic reactions to the dye. The American Academy of Dermatology recommends a patch test 48 hours before application. For instance, a study by Han et al. (2018) found that 2% of people have allergic reactions to hair dye, which can lead to severe discomfort or skin issues.

How Can You Maintain Your Black Hair Dye’s Vibrancy and Shine Over Time?
To maintain the vibrancy and shine of black hair dye over time, consistently follow specific hair care practices. These practices include using color-safe products, avoiding excessive heat, and regular conditioning.
-
Use color-safe products: Choose shampoos and conditioners specifically formulated for colored hair. These products often contain fewer sulfates, which can strip color. A 2021 study in the Journal of Cosmetic Science highlighted that sulfate-free shampoos help maintain hair dye vibrancy.
-
Limit heat exposure: Frequent use of heat styling tools can fade color. Heat can also damage hair’s cuticle, leading to dullness. It’s advisable to air dry hair or use heat tools on a low setting. According to a study in the International Journal of Trichology (2019), minimizing heat application can significantly prolong the life of your hair color.
-
Regular deep conditioning: Deep conditioning treatments help restore moisture in dyed hair. Look for conditioners containing ingredients like argan oil or shea butter. These ingredients provide hydration and help retain shine. Research published in the International Journal of Cosmetic Science (2020) found that deep conditioners can improve hair texture and appearance.
-
Avoid direct sunlight: UV rays can fade hair dye. Protect your hair by wearing hats or using UV-protective hair sprays when outdoors. The American Academy of Dermatology advises such precautions to minimize color fading.
-
Schedule regular touch-ups: Regular touch-ups maintain color consistency and vibrancy. It’s usually recommended to refresh color every 4-6 weeks, depending on hair growth and fading.
Implementing these practices consistently can help keep your black hair dye looking vibrant and shiny.
